1. High Rental Income Potential

The demand for short-term rentals in Bali is substantial, especially in top tourist areas. By investing in a villa in Bali, you can expect a steady stream of income from tourists, expats, and vacationers.

Average Monthly Rental Income

  • Luxury Villas: Can generate between $5,000 and $10,000 per month depending on the property’s features and location.

  • Mid-range Villas: Offer approximately $2,000 to $4,000 per month.

  • Budget Villas: Typically bring in $1,000 to $2,000 per month.

2. Strong Capital Appreciation

Bali has seen a consistent rise in property values, making it an attractive option for investors seeking long-term gains. The growing demand for luxurious properties in areas like Uluwatu and Padang Padang ensures that villas will continue to appreciate in value.

Price Growth Statistics

  • Uluwatu has seen an average annual price increase of 5-10% over the last five years.

  • Bingin is gaining in popularity, with many new developments contributing to price hikes.

Best Areas to Invest in a Villa in Bali

To maximize returns on your investment, selecting the right location is crucial. Bali offers various regions, each with its own unique appeal.

Uluwatu: A Prime Location for Luxury Villas

Uluwatu is synonymous with luxury and breathtaking views. The demand for villas in this area is consistently high, making it one of the most lucrative areas for villa investments. Uluwatu also boasts some of the island’s most famous beaches, which increases its attraction to tourists.

Bingin: A Hidden Gem for Investment

Bingin is a serene and growing area, loved by surfers and those seeking a quieter side of Bali. The region’s beauty and peaceful atmosphere are driving an increase in real estate prices, making it a wise investment opportunity.

Padang Padang: Exclusive and High-End Villas

Padang Padang offers a more exclusive and tranquil atmosphere, ideal for luxury villa investments. It attracts both tourists and affluent expats, guaranteeing a strong rental demand year-round.
